Thruway to begin construction on new bridge linking Cuomo bridge path and Lyndhurst
The Thruway Authority announced Monday it would begin construction in Tarrytown on May 29 on a bridge lengthening the pedestrian path of the Gov. Mario M. Cuomo Bridge to other Tarrytown attractions, including the Lyndhurst Mansion, the Old Croton Aqueduct trail and the RiverWalk, in time for the summer season.

Congratulations to the April 2024 River Journal Pet of the Month
Remy, the three-year-old Chihuahua mix, found his forever home after being adopted by his loving human companion from Paws Crossed Animal Rescue. Despite his small stature, he has a big personality and is great at making you laugh at his antics. Remy would describe himself as a professional lap sitter and always on the lookout for the perfect spot to cozy up and relax.
